Troubleshooting Myers Well Pump Issues
Dealing with a non-functioning Myers well pump can be a real headache. Before you call a professional, take a deep breath and try some common troubleshooting steps. First, check if your {well's{power supply is working correctly by inspecting your electrical connections. Make sure the toggle for your well pump is in the run position. Next, investigate the {pressure tank{ to see if it's properly charged. If you hear any unusual sounds coming from the pump, like grinding or rattling, that could indicate a {serious{ problem.
- Review the {well's{ pressure switch for any signs of damage.
- Remove debris from any dirt or particles that may be clogging the pump's intake.
- {Check{ your well pump's supply line for leaks or damage.
If you've gone through the list and your well pump is still not working, it's best to consult a qualified technician. They can pinpoint the {problem{ and repair it correctly.
Maintaining Your Myers Water Well Pump for Longevity
Ensuring your Myers water well pump operates at peak performance and extends its lifespan is crucial. Regular upkeep involves a few key steps. First, examine the pump's features for any damage. This includes checking belts, hoses, and electrical connections for concerns. Second, wash the well pump according to the manufacturer's instructions. A clean pump functions more efficiently. Finally, consider setting up regular professional inspections to identify potential issues before they become major repairs.
- Regularly checking your well pump's pressure switch and adjusting it as needed is essential for optimal performance.
- Ensuring the surrounding area around your well pump free from debris and vegetation can help prevent issues.
